Industrial Chic



Integrate resources and smooth surfaces to attain an industrial posh aesthetic in your barber store style. Welcome the beauty of exposed brick walls, concrete floorings, and metal accents to produce a contemporary yet rugged environment. Think about mounting industrial-style lights fixtures like pendant lights with Edison bulbs or track lighting to add a touch of city elegance.

To complement the industrial vibe, choose furniture items made of recovered timber or metal. Industrial shelving units can show grooming items or classic barber devices, adding a sense of credibility to the room. Look for barber chairs with metal structures and leather upholstery to link the look with each other.

Integrating commercial elements doesn't indicate giving up comfort. Include soft fabrics like luxurious rugs or leather footrests to cancel the more difficult textures in the area. Mixing industrial and relaxing aspects will develop a welcoming environment for your customers while still preserving the edgy commercial chic design.

Modern Minimalism



Accomplishing a contemporary minimal aesthetic in your barber shop design involves focusing on clean lines and minimalist rooms. Embracing simpleness is vital to this style. Choose streamlined furniture with minimal styles to develop a feeling of openness and refinement. Select a neutral shade palette, such as whites, grays, and blacks, to maintain a tidy and natural appearance throughout your barbershop. Integrate natural environments like timber or rock to add heat and structure to the room without subduing its minimal vibe.

When choosing decor elements, much less is more. Maintain decors to a minimum and choose items that serve a function while contributing to the overall visual. Consider including geometric shapes or abstract art to add visual passion without producing visual mess.

Lights is important in a modern-day minimal layout. Choose basic, statement lights components that illuminate the space successfully while complementing the tidy and minimalist ambience.
